Your Nissan engine is a crucial part of your
vehicle and would need to be checked regularly because if one or more
parts of the system failed to function properly, the whole operation of
the vehicle would malfunction and could prompt more chances of dangers
on the road. There are many reasons why an engine would fail to
function properly but common complaints of faulty engine is that there
are oil leaks. Though it may sound difficult to fix, this is a simple
matter that more often the valve cover or valve cover gaskets are the
parts involved for the leakage. The solution could be as simple as
replacing the valve cover gasket as when over time it becomes
saturated it can no longer prevent the oil from leaking out. If
this is the problem of your engine, you only need some tools, gasket
adhesive and, of course, replacement valve cover gaskets.
On the other hand, if the problem is more serious and solution is more
than replacing new valve cover gasket, look into the valve cover itself
and it may also need to be replaced because of age or the component is
made of materials that corrode over using it in a period of time. Cast
aluminum-made valve covers are usually those that would require
replacement after some time of using. Replacing valve cover is also not
a reason to get you worried as there is an abundance of Nissan
replacement valve covers in the automotive market. Unlike cast aluminum
valve covers, those that are made of sheet metal are usually reusable
and will only need to be straightened if this is already bent or
distorted. You can usually find this kind of valve covers in older
models of the automobiles.
Whichever of the two situations is the source of the oil leaks in your
Nissan engine, replacing it should be taken with great care because the
hardest part of replacing valve cover or valve cover gasket is getting
into it. Getting to the valve covers are usually tough because there
are some engine components that are in the way. In most cases, you
would have to remove spark plug and the air filter to get through to
the valve cover. If you are not confident enough of doing the job, it
is best to consult a professional mechanic to aid you in this task.
